Quantum alerts can degrade in excess of length as a result of loss of photons in optical fibers. This restrictions the successful number of QKD, rendering it demanding to maintain a secure key distribution channel above extensive distances. Research into satellite-centered QKD is underway to overcome this challenge.
The trick into the Diffie-Hellman approach was for 2 men and women to build The crucial element utilizing a simple mathematical problem that’s easy to compute in one path and laborious in the other. In this article’s how it really works: The two people that want to speak secretly, usually selected Alice and Bob in these setups, Every single opt for a top secret selection. Then, alongside one another, they concur on the pair of quantities they share publicly (a single is a huge prime, and the opposite is called the base). Every of them future carries out a series of mathematical operations to mix Individuals personal numbers with the primary and The bottom.
The common computer systems that a lot of people use daily are developed within the binary logic of bits, that happen to be based upon 0 and 1 as represented by a binary physical home, which include no matter whether move of electric power to some transistor is off or on. These traditional computers are typically often called classical personal computers when discussed in relation to quantum computers. In contrast to your binary mother nature of classical computers, quantum personal computers use qubits, which are effective at currently being in a superposition of two states at the same time (i.
Quantum cryptography is usually a groundbreaking strategy that has the likely to offer unparalleled security actions dependant on the ideas of quantum mechanics. In distinction to traditional cryptography, which depends on advanced mathematical difficulties, quantum cryptography utilises the exceptional properties of quantum particles to determine an unbreakable encryption process. Among the list of vital parts of the tactic is quantum key distribution (QKD), which allows two get-togethers to deliver a solution and shared random essential that can be used for secure communication.
